Differences between Seed Potatoes and Potato Seeds

Seed potatoes and potato seeds are two distinct types of potato starting materials. Seed potatoes are actually small pieces of mature potatoes that have at least one “eye” each, while potato seeds refer to the seeds produced by potato plants. However, potato seeds are not commonly used for cultivation because they produce inconsistent results and may not retain the characteristics of the parent plant.

Temperature Requirements for Potato Planting

Potatoes require a cool to moderate temperature to grow well.
The ideal temperature range for potato planting is between 60°F (15°C) and 70°F (21°C).
If the temperature drops below 50°F (10°C), growth will slow down, and if it rises above 75°F (24°C), the potatoes may become scabby and develop other problems.
It’s essential to monitor the temperature using a thermometer, especially in regions with temperature fluctuations.

General Inquiries

Q: Can I grow potatoes in small containers?

A: Yes, you can grow potatoes in small containers, but they require more attention and frequent watering. Choose a container that is at least 6-8 inches deep and has good drainage.

Q: What is the best type of soil for growing potatoes in containers?

A: Look for a potting mix specifically designed for containers, with good drainage and a pH between 4.5 and 7.0. Avoid using garden soil from the ground, as it may contain pests or diseases.

Q: Can I use regular potatoes for seed potatoes?

A: No, regular potatoes are not suitable for seed potatoes. They may spread disease or produce deformed tubers. Only use certified disease-free seed potatoes for the best results.

Q: How often should I water my container potatoes?

A: Water your container potatoes when the top 1-2 inches of soil feel dry to the touch. Avoid overwatering, which can lead to rot and disease.
